How Our Structural Drying Services Work
When you call us for structural drying services, our team springs into action. We know that the first few hours after water damage occur are crucial in preventing long-term damage. That’s why we’ll arrive on site within 60 minutes and get to work assessing the situation.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will evaluate the extent of the damage and create a customized plan to dry out your home. This may involve setting up air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the process.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use submersible pumps to extract any standing water from your home, making sure to dry out carpets and padding to pr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ure that your home is completely dry and free of moisture. This may take 3-5 days dep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Once your home is dry, our technicians will assess any necessary repairs to get your home back to normal. This may involve replacing damaged drywall or repairing structural elements.

Structural Drying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ill in a bathroom | Yes | No | It’s a small area and can be dried quickly with a wet/dry vacuum. |
| Basement flood with standing water | No | Yes | It’s a large area and needs specialized equipment to dry out safely and effectively. |
| Leaky pipe under the sink | Yes | No | It’s a small area and can be dried quickly with a wet/dry vacuum. |
| Roof leak with water stains on ceiling | No | Yes | It’s a structural issue that needs professional attention to prevent further damage.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e in the attic | No | Yes | It’s a complex issue that needs specialized equipment and expertise to dry out safely and effectively. |
| Small water spill in a bedroom | Yes | No | It’s a small area and can be dried quickly with a wet/dry vacuum. |

Structural Drying Services Cost In Euless, TX
The cost of structural drying services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Euless, TX. These are estimates, not guarantees. We’ll provide a free on-site assessment to find out the extent of the damage and provide a customized quote.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Response |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Water Extraction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and amount of water extracted.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of drying process. |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, type of repairs needed, and local labor costs. |
| Specialized Equipment Rental | $500 – $2,000 | Duration of rental, type of equipment used, and local rental costs. |
| Free On-Site Assessment | $0 – $500 | Distance to the affected area, type of assessment needed, and local labor costs. |
